Turf Toe: Symptoms, Causes, Treatment and Recovery
Turf toe is a sprain of the main joint at the base of the big toe, medically known as the first metatarsophalangeal joint, or first MTP joint. It usually happens when the big toe is forced upward beyond its normal range while the front of the foot remains planted. The injury can stretch or tear the soft tissues underneath the joint, particularly the plantar plate and surrounding structures that help stabilize the big toe.
The injury is strongly associated with sports that involve sprinting, cutting, jumping, and pushing forcefully through the forefoot. Football players are commonly affected, but turf toe can also occur in soccer, basketball, wrestling, gymnastics, dance, and other activities that repeatedly load the big toe. Despite the name, the injury is not limited to artificial turf and can occur on many playing surfaces.
Symptoms can range from mild tenderness after activity to severe pain, swelling, bruising, and difficulty walking. Sports medicine professionals commonly classify turf toe into three grades based on how badly the supporting tissues have been damaged: a mild Grade 1 sprain, a partial Grade 2 tear, and a severe Grade 3 complete tear.
Most cases can be managed without surgery, especially mild and moderate injuries. Rest, protection of the joint, footwear modifications, temporary immobilization, and gradual rehabilitation are commonly used. Severe injuries may take several months to heal, however, and a small number require surgery when the joint is unstable or important structures have been significantly disrupted.
What Is Turf Toe?
Turf toe is a soft-tissue injury involving the structures surrounding the big toe joint. The joint connects the first metatarsal bone in the foot to the first bone of the big toe and plays an important role whenever you walk, run, jump, or push off the ground. The plantar plate beneath the joint helps prevent the toe from bending excessively upward.
The injury occurs when this joint is suddenly or repeatedly hyperextended. Imagine the front of your foot planted against the ground while your heel rises and another force pushes your body forward. If the big toe remains fixed while the rest of the foot moves, the toe can bend farther backward than its supporting tissues are designed to tolerate.
The resulting damage can range from microscopic stretching of the plantar structures to a partial or complete tear. Severe injuries may also involve surrounding ligaments, joint surfaces, or the small sesamoid bones underneath the first metatarsal head. That is why two athletes both diagnosed with turf toe can have dramatically different symptoms and recovery times.
Although the name sounds relatively harmless, turf toe can significantly affect athletic performance. The big toe provides substantial leverage during push-off, so pain or instability at this joint can interfere with sprinting, jumping, acceleration, cutting, and even ordinary walking. Early recognition and appropriate rehabilitation can help prevent a minor injury from becoming a persistent problem.
Why Is It Called Turf Toe?
The term “turf toe” became widely associated with athletes competing on artificial playing surfaces. Early artificial turf was often harder than natural grass, while some athletic footwear designed for those surfaces was relatively flexible through the forefoot. That combination allowed the toe to bend upward while the shoe provided limited resistance.
The injury is not caused exclusively by artificial turf, however. Athletes can develop the same hyperextension injury on natural grass, gym floors, wrestling mats, dance surfaces, or virtually anywhere the forefoot becomes fixed while the big toe bends backward.
Footwear remains relevant because shoes vary in how much they allow the forefoot to flex. Very flexible shoes can increase movement through the big toe joint, whereas shoes or inserts with greater forefoot stiffness can limit excessive extension in some situations.
Modern sports medicine therefore uses “turf toe” primarily as the name of the injury rather than as a statement about where it occurred. The underlying problem is damage to the plantar structures of the first MTP joint, regardless of whether the athlete was playing on artificial turf, natural grass, or another surface.
Common Turf Toe Symptoms
The most typical turf toe symptom is pain at the base of the big toe. The discomfort is often concentrated underneath or around the first MTP joint and may become particularly noticeable when the person pushes off the forefoot during walking, running, jumping, or climbing stairs.
Swelling can develop around the joint as injured tissues become inflamed. Mild injuries may produce only subtle puffiness, while more significant sprains can cause obvious swelling and bruising. Tenderness is often greatest around the plantar surface underneath the joint where the supporting tissues have been overstretched.
Movement can also become uncomfortable. Bending the big toe upward may reproduce the pain, and athletes sometimes notice reduced range of motion because swelling and tenderness make the joint feel stiff. Some people compensate by walking on the outside of the foot to avoid loading the painful big toe.
Severe turf toe may cause immediate intense pain and make it difficult to continue playing. An athlete may feel unable to push off normally or notice that the joint feels unstable. A Grade 3 injury represents complete disruption of the plantar plate and can require a much longer recovery than a simple Grade 1 sprain.
What Does Turf Toe Feel Like?
A mild turf toe injury may initially feel like soreness underneath the big toe rather than a dramatic injury. The athlete might finish training but notice increasing discomfort afterward, particularly when extending the toe or pushing through the front of the foot.
Moderate injuries tend to produce more obvious pain and swelling. Running, accelerating, changing direction, or rising onto the toes can become uncomfortable because those movements load the first MTP joint heavily. Walking may still be possible, but the person often changes their gait to protect the injured area.
A severe injury can feel sharp immediately when the toe is forced backward. The athlete may need to stop activity at once, and bruising or significant swelling may develop relatively quickly. Weight-bearing and push-off can become extremely difficult because the structures responsible for stabilizing the joint have been substantially damaged.
The sensation can sometimes be confused with a fracture, sesamoid injury, arthritis, or another cause of big toe pain. The mechanism of injury and physical examination are therefore important. Significant pain after sudden forced hyperextension should be evaluated rather than assumed to be simple soreness.
What Causes Turf Toe?
The classic cause is hyperextension of the big toe. This occurs when the toe remains planted while the heel lifts and the body moves forward. The forces are transferred through the plantar structures underneath the joint, which can stretch or tear when the movement exceeds their normal capacity.
Football is one of the sports most closely associated with the injury because players frequently accelerate from a crouched position, push through the forefoot, and experience contact from other athletes. A player may have the toe planted while another player lands on the back of the foot or leg, forcing the joint farther upward.
Soccer, basketball, rugby, wrestling, gymnastics, sprinting, and dance can create similar mechanics. Any sport involving repeated forefoot loading, sudden acceleration, jumping, or abrupt direction changes can place stress on the big toe joint.
Turf toe can also develop gradually rather than during one memorable incident. Repeated hyperextension over many training sessions may irritate the plantar structures until pain and stiffness begin interfering with performance. This type of repetitive stress can be easier to overlook because there may be no single moment when the athlete remembers getting hurt.
Who Is Most at Risk for Turf Toe?
Athletes involved in sports requiring explosive push-off are among those most likely to develop turf toe. Football running backs, receivers, linemen, and other players frequently use the big toe to generate force during acceleration and direction changes.
Soccer and basketball players are also vulnerable because these sports involve sprinting, cutting, jumping, and rapid transitions. Wrestlers can sustain the injury when their toes remain planted against the mat while another athlete forces their body forward.
Footwear may influence risk as well. Highly flexible shoes allow greater movement through the forefoot. Although flexibility can be beneficial for certain athletic movements, inadequate support around an already vulnerable big toe joint may allow excessive extension.
Previous turf toe is another potential risk factor because an incompletely rehabilitated joint may remain painful, stiff, or unstable. Returning to sport before strength, motion, and functional push-off have recovered can expose healing tissues to repeated stress.
Turf Toe Grades Explained
Sports medicine professionals generally divide turf toe into three grades according to the amount of tissue damage. This classification helps guide treatment and gives athletes a rough idea of how much activity modification and recovery time may be required.
A Grade 1 turf toe injury involves stretching or a mild sprain of the plantar structures. Pain and swelling are generally limited, and the athlete can often bear weight. Treatment may involve ice, brief rest, taping, and a rigid shoe insert or stiff-soled footwear.
A Grade 2 injury involves a partial tear of the plantar plate. Pain, swelling, tenderness, and reduced motion are usually more noticeable. Running and pushing off become difficult, and temporary immobilization may be appropriate while the tissues begin healing.
A Grade 3 turf toe injury involves complete disruption of the plantar plate or supporting structures. The athlete may have severe pain, bruising, swelling, and considerable difficulty bearing weight or pushing off. These injuries can require several months of recovery, and selected severe cases may need surgery.
Grade 1 Turf Toe Symptoms and Treatment
Grade 1 is the mildest form of turf toe. The supporting tissues have been stretched but remain largely intact. The athlete may experience tenderness beneath the big toe, mild swelling, and pain when the joint is pushed upward.
Walking is often possible, although sprinting or explosive push-off may hurt. Because the injury seems relatively minor, athletes sometimes continue playing without giving the tissue enough time to settle down.
Initial management commonly involves reducing activities that reproduce pain, applying ice, and limiting excessive upward movement of the toe. Taping and a rigid forefoot insert may help reduce stress on the plantar plate when the athlete begins returning to activity.
Some Grade 1 injuries improve within approximately a week when appropriately protected, although recovery varies between individuals. Returning too aggressively can prolong irritation, so pain-free walking and functional movement should generally come before unrestricted competition.
Grade 2 Turf Toe Symptoms and Treatment
Grade 2 turf toe represents a partial tear of the structures underneath the big toe joint. The athlete usually notices greater swelling and tenderness than with a Grade 1 injury, and bruising may become visible.
Walking can become uncomfortable, especially during the push-off phase of each step. Running, jumping, or changing direction is generally much harder because those movements require the big toe to tolerate considerable load.
Treatment may involve a period of reduced weight-bearing or immobilization. A walking boot can sometimes be used temporarily to prevent excessive movement while the injured tissues begin healing. Once symptoms improve, rehabilitation focuses gradually on restoring range of motion and strength.
Recovery frequently takes longer than a mild sprain. Cleveland Clinic notes that Grade 2 turf toe may resolve in roughly two to three weeks in some cases, although return to high-level sport depends on functional recovery rather than the calendar alone.
Grade 3 Turf Toe Symptoms and Treatment
Grade 3 is the most severe category and involves complete tearing of the plantar plate or major supporting structures. Pain may be immediate and intense, and athletes often struggle to continue participating after the injury.
Significant swelling and bruising can develop around the first MTP joint. The joint may feel unstable, and normal push-off can become impossible because the tissues that normally support the big toe are no longer functioning correctly.
Treatment usually begins with substantial protection or immobilization. A walking boot or cast may be used, depending on the injury, and weight-bearing may need to be limited while healing begins. Rehabilitation becomes progressively more active as stability and pain improve.
Grade 3 recovery may take two to six months, particularly when the injury is extensive. Surgery is uncommon overall but may be considered when there is major instability, dislocation, severe tissue disruption, or failure of appropriate nonsurgical treatment.
How Is Turf Toe Diagnosed?
Diagnosis usually begins with a detailed description of how the injury happened. A clinician may ask whether the big toe was forced backward, whether the person felt immediate pain, and whether they could continue walking or competing afterward.
The physical examination commonly includes checking tenderness, swelling, bruising, stability, and range of motion around the first MTP joint. The healthcare professional may gently move the big toe while evaluating which positions reproduce pain.
Imaging may be used when the injury is significant or when another diagnosis needs to be excluded. X-rays do not directly show a soft-tissue plantar plate tear, but they can identify fractures, joint alignment problems, or abnormalities involving the sesamoid bones.
More advanced imaging, such as MRI, may be considered when doctors need to examine the plantar plate and surrounding soft tissues more clearly. Imaging decisions depend on injury severity, examination findings, athletic demands, and whether symptoms are improving as expected.
Turf Toe vs a Broken Big Toe
Turf toe and a big toe fracture can both cause pain, swelling, and difficulty walking. The main difference is that turf toe primarily involves soft tissues supporting the joint, whereas a fracture involves a break in one of the bones.
The mechanism can provide clues. Turf toe often occurs when the big toe is hyperextended, while fractures may follow a direct impact, crushing injury, awkward landing, or forceful collision. Nevertheless, one injury mechanism can occasionally damage both bone and soft tissue.
Bruising and swelling can occur with either injury, making visual inspection unreliable. Severe tenderness over a specific bone, deformity, or inability to bear weight can increase suspicion for fracture but does not confirm it.
X-rays may therefore be useful when significant trauma has occurred. Because fractures and turf toe require somewhat different management, persistent or severe pain should be assessed rather than diagnosed solely based on symptoms.
Turf Toe vs Sesamoiditis
The sesamoids are two small bones located beneath the first metatarsal head near the big toe joint. They function somewhat like pulleys and help the tendons generate force during push-off.
Sesamoiditis usually develops from repetitive stress rather than one sudden hyperextension injury. Pain tends to occur underneath the ball of the foot and may gradually increase during running, dancing, or other activities that repeatedly load the forefoot.
Turf toe, by comparison, commonly follows forced extension of the big toe and involves the supporting soft tissues around the first MTP joint. Severe turf toe injuries can sometimes affect the sesamoid complex as well, which creates overlap between the conditions.
Because sesamoid stress injuries, fractures, and turf toe can produce similar pain locations, medical evaluation may be useful when symptoms persist. Treatment usually depends on exactly which structure has been injured and how much loading it can safely tolerate.
Turf Toe vs Gout
Gout can cause severe pain in the big toe joint, making it another condition sometimes confused with turf toe. Gout is an inflammatory arthritis caused by urate crystals accumulating in or around joints.
A gout attack often begins suddenly without a sports injury. The joint may become extremely painful, swollen, warm, and visibly red, and even light contact from clothing can feel uncomfortable. The first big toe joint is a common location for gout attacks.
Turf toe is usually linked to trauma or repeated mechanical stress. Pain is commonly worsened by bending the toe upward or pushing through the forefoot rather than developing spontaneously while resting.
Anyone experiencing intense unexplained big toe swelling without a clear injury should consider medical evaluation rather than assuming turf toe. Gout, infection, arthritis, fractures, and other conditions may require different treatment.
Initial Turf Toe Treatment
Immediately after an injury, the main goal is to protect the joint from repeated hyperextension. Continuing to sprint, jump, or push aggressively through a painful big toe may worsen tissue damage and prolong recovery.
Rest from aggravating activity and application of cold packs can help manage early pain and swelling. Ice should generally be wrapped rather than placed directly against bare skin. Elevating the foot while resting may also help limit swelling.
Compression or supportive taping may be useful in selected injuries, but techniques should avoid restricting circulation or placing the toe in a painful position. Athletes frequently benefit from guidance from a sports medicine professional, athletic trainer, or physical therapist.
Pain-relieving medication may occasionally be appropriate depending on the person’s medical history, but medication should not be used simply to hide symptoms so an athlete can continue loading an unstable joint. Protecting the injured tissues is an essential part of recovery.
Does the RICE Method Help Turf Toe?
The traditional RICE approach—rest, ice, compression, and elevation—is commonly used during the early phase of turf toe management to reduce stress and control symptoms. Sports medicine sources continue to include these measures among nonsurgical treatment options.
Rest does not necessarily mean complete inactivity for weeks. It means avoiding activities that force the toe into painful extension while allowing the injured structures an opportunity to heal. Low-impact alternatives may eventually be introduced when they do not reproduce symptoms.
Ice can be particularly useful for temporary pain relief after an acute injury. Short sessions with a wrapped cold pack are generally more appropriate than placing ice directly on the skin.
Compression and elevation may help with swelling, but their role depends on the severity of the injury. More significant turf toe frequently requires additional measures such as a walking boot, rigid insert, taping, or other forms of joint protection.
Should You Tape Turf Toe?
Taping can help limit excessive upward movement of the big toe and may be used during recovery from mild or moderate turf toe. The goal is to provide support without completely eliminating necessary movement or compromising circulation.
Athletes sometimes use taping when transitioning back into training. Combined with a stiff shoe or rigid insert, it can reduce stress on the plantar plate during push-off.
Technique matters. Taping too tightly may cause numbness, tingling, discoloration, or discomfort, while poorly positioned tape may fail to support the joint. Athletic trainers and physical therapists can demonstrate an appropriate approach.
Taping should not be used as a way to continue competing through a severe injury. A Grade 2 or Grade 3 injury may need temporary immobilization and structured rehabilitation rather than simple sideline taping.
Best Shoes for Turf Toe Recovery
Footwear can influence how much the big toe bends during walking and athletic activity. A shoe with a relatively stiff forefoot can reduce excessive extension through the first MTP joint and may make everyday walking more comfortable during recovery.
Rigid inserts or carbon-type plates are sometimes placed inside shoes to limit forefoot bending. Sports medicine guidance includes rigid shoe inserts among conservative options for protecting the plantar plate.
The best shoe varies by sport, foot shape, injury grade, and phase of recovery. An athlete returning to football may need different footwear characteristics from someone recovering for everyday walking.
Footwear alone will not repair a major plantar plate tear. It should be viewed as one component of an overall treatment strategy that may also involve rest, rehabilitation, taping, temporary immobilization, and gradual return to activity.
When Is a Walking Boot Needed?
A walking boot may be recommended when pain and tissue damage are significant enough that ordinary shoes do not sufficiently protect the joint. Immobilization reduces the amount of big toe movement during everyday walking.
Grade 2 injuries sometimes benefit from a temporary period in a boot, particularly when normal walking is painful. The goal is to allow the partially torn plantar structures to begin healing without being repeatedly stretched.
Grade 3 injuries commonly require more substantial immobilization. Mass General Brigham notes that more serious turf toe injuries may be treated with a boot and that immobilization time generally increases with injury severity.
A boot should not necessarily be worn indefinitely. Prolonged immobilization can contribute to stiffness and weakness, so movement and rehabilitation are generally reintroduced according to healing progress and professional guidance.
Physical Therapy for Turf Toe
Physical therapy can become particularly valuable after moderate or severe turf toe. Once the injured structures have had enough time to settle, rehabilitation focuses on restoring comfortable joint movement and rebuilding strength through the foot and lower leg.
Early rehabilitation may include gentle mobility exercises that avoid forcing the toe into painful hyperextension. The objective is to prevent excessive stiffness without stressing tissues that are still healing.
Strengthening gradually becomes more important as pain decreases. Exercises may target the intrinsic muscles of the foot, calf, ankle, and muscles involved in controlling the big toe. Overall lower-body strength also matters because running and jumping rely on coordinated movement through the entire kinetic chain.
Later rehabilitation introduces sport-specific loading. An athlete may progress from walking to controlled strengthening, then jogging, running, acceleration, jumping, and eventually cutting or competition. Return should be based on function and symptoms rather than simply reaching a predetermined date.
Turf Toe Exercises During Recovery
Exercise selection should match the stage of healing. Immediately after a significant injury, aggressive stretching of the big toe may reproduce the original hyperextension mechanism and should generally be avoided.
Once a healthcare professional considers movement appropriate, gentle range-of-motion work may help restore flexibility. The toe should move within a comfortable range rather than being forced into substantial pain.
Strengthening exercises can eventually target the foot muscles and calf. Controlled calf raises and other functional movements may be added as the athlete becomes able to load the forefoot without significant discomfort. Rehabilitation guidance often gradually reintroduces calf work and big toe motion while avoiding excessive extension.
Later stages should recreate the demands of the person’s sport. A football or soccer athlete needs to tolerate sprinting and direction changes, while a dancer may need excellent forefoot control and balance. Rehabilitation therefore becomes increasingly individualized as return to activity approaches.
How Long Does Turf Toe Take to Heal?
Turf toe recovery time depends heavily on injury grade. Mild injuries can improve relatively quickly, while complete tears may require months before athletes regain full confidence and function.
Cleveland Clinic reports that Grade 1 injuries may improve within approximately one week with rest. Grade 2 injuries may take around two to three weeks, although individual recovery can vary depending on tissue damage and athletic demands.
Grade 3 injuries may require approximately two to six months of healing. Severe injuries involving surgery can take even longer before the athlete is ready for unrestricted sport.
Recovery timelines should be treated as estimates rather than promises. An athlete whose toe remains painful, swollen, weak, or unstable is not fully recovered simply because a certain number of weeks has passed. Functional testing and gradual progression provide better information than the calendar alone.
When Can You Walk Normally After Turf Toe?
People with mild Grade 1 turf toe can often continue walking, although pushing through the injured toe may feel uncomfortable initially. A stiff-soled shoe or insert may reduce the amount of painful motion.
Moderate Grade 2 injuries can make normal walking more difficult. The person may limp or unconsciously shift weight toward the outside of the foot. Temporary protection may be useful until walking becomes comfortable again.
Severe injuries can make normal walking difficult or impossible without a boot, crutches, or another form of support. Weight-bearing recommendations depend on the extent of tissue disruption and should follow professional guidance.
Walking normally is an important milestone but is not the same as being ready for sport. Sprinting and cutting expose the joint to forces far greater than everyday walking, so athletic progression should continue gradually after normal gait has returned.
When Can You Return to Sports?
Return to sport depends on injury severity and whether the athlete can perform necessary movements without significant pain, instability, or compensation. Mild injuries may allow relatively quick return when the joint is protected.
Moderate injuries usually require more patience. Athletes should be able to walk, jog, push off, and gradually accelerate before immediately attempting full-speed competition.
Cutting, jumping, and explosive sprinting should usually come later because these movements place substantial force through the big toe. Sport-specific drills can reveal whether the joint is ready to tolerate those demands.
Returning prematurely can turn an acute injury into persistent pain, stiffness, or instability. Coaches and athletes should therefore treat functional readiness as more important than pressure to return for a particular match or event.
Can You Play Through Turf Toe?
Some athletes with a mild Grade 1 injury can continue participating with appropriate protection, particularly when pain is limited and joint stability remains intact. Sports medicine guidance notes that Grade 1 cases may sometimes be managed with short rest followed by taping and a rigid insert.
Playing through a moderate injury is more questionable. Pain during push-off changes movement mechanics, potentially placing additional stress on the ankle, knee, hip, or opposite leg.
Continuing competition through a severe Grade 3 injury can further damage already compromised structures. Significant swelling, instability, inability to push off, or severe pain should be treated as signs to stop rather than challenges to overcome.
Pain tolerance is not the same as tissue healing. An athlete may be capable of enduring discomfort while still worsening the underlying injury, particularly if medication or adrenaline makes symptoms temporarily easier to ignore.
Can Turf Toe Become Chronic?
Yes. Turf toe that is repeatedly aggravated or insufficiently rehabilitated can become a chronic problem. Ongoing symptoms may include pain, swelling, stiffness, weakness during push-off, or a feeling that the joint is unstable.
Repeated injury can also affect athletic performance. An athlete may subconsciously shorten stride length, avoid loading the big toe, or lose confidence during acceleration and cutting.
Chronic plantar plate damage can be more difficult to treat than an acute sprain because the tissues may heal in a lengthened or unstable position. ACFAS literature specifically recognizes chronic turf toe as a potential problem when nonsurgical treatment fails.
Persistent symptoms should therefore not be ignored simply because the original injury occurred months ago. Sports medicine or foot-and-ankle evaluation can help determine whether ongoing symptoms reflect incomplete healing, instability, arthritis, sesamoid involvement, or another condition.
Can Turf Toe Cause Arthritis?
Significant injury to the first MTP joint can potentially contribute to long-term joint problems, particularly if instability or cartilage damage persists. Repeated injury can alter how forces are transmitted through the joint during walking and athletics.
Chronic stiffness may also develop when an injured joint remains immobilized too long or when pain repeatedly limits normal movement. This can reduce the big toe’s ability to extend comfortably during push-off.
Not every person with turf toe develops arthritis. Most mild injuries recover appropriately when given adequate protection and rehabilitation.
The greatest concern generally involves severe, recurrent, or untreated injuries. Protecting the joint and restoring normal mechanics can help reduce long-term complications and preserve athletic function.
When Does Turf Toe Need Surgery?
Most turf toe injuries are treated without surgery. Mild and moderate sprains typically respond to protection, temporary activity modification, footwear changes, and progressive rehabilitation.
Surgery is considered more often with severe Grade 3 injuries. Examples may include major instability, dislocation, significant disruption of the plantar structures, displaced sesamoid-related injuries, or other structural damage that cannot heal adequately with conservative treatment.
Mass General Brigham notes that surgery is uncommon but may be appropriate when severe injuries involve complete tears or joint dislocation and immobilization is insufficient.
Surgical recovery is longer than treatment for a mild sprain because repaired tissues need time to heal before aggressive loading begins. Rehabilitation afterward gradually restores motion, strength, and sport-specific function.
How to Prevent Turf Toe
No prevention strategy can eliminate every turf toe injury, particularly in contact sports where another athlete may land on a planted foot. However, reducing unnecessary hyperextension stress can lower risk.
Proper athletic footwear is one important consideration. Shoes that provide appropriate forefoot stability for the sport can help limit excessive motion through the big toe joint. Mass General Brigham recommends supportive footwear as one strategy for reducing risk.
Athletes with previous turf toe may benefit from rigid inserts, orthotics, or taping when recommended by their sports medicine team. These strategies can provide additional joint protection during high-demand activity.
Conditioning matters too. Maintaining foot, ankle, calf, and lower-body strength helps athletes control force during running and cutting. Adequate rehabilitation after a previous injury is particularly important because returning with persistent weakness or stiffness may increase the chance of recurrence.
Can Turf Toe Be Prevented With Inserts?
Rigid shoe inserts can help reduce bending through the forefoot, which is why they are commonly used both during recovery and for protection in athletes who have previously experienced turf toe.
Carbon or graphite-type plates are relatively thin but stiff. By limiting forefoot extension inside the shoe, they can reduce the amount the big toe bends backward during push-off.
Sports Medicine Today includes rigid shoe inserts as part of conservative treatment for Grade 1 injuries, often alongside taping and brief activity modification.
An insert should still fit comfortably and work with the athlete’s footwear. Excessive stiffness or poor fit can create problems elsewhere in the foot, so athletes with recurrent symptoms may benefit from professional fitting or sports medicine guidance.
When Should You See a Doctor for Turf Toe?
A mild toe sprain that rapidly improves with rest and protection may not require extensive evaluation. However, significant pain after hyperextension deserves more attention.
Seek medical assessment if you cannot bear weight normally, the joint becomes very swollen or bruised, pain is severe, or the toe feels unstable. These findings can suggest a more significant plantar plate injury or another problem such as fracture.
Persistent symptoms are another reason for evaluation. If big toe pain continues despite several days of reasonable protection or repeatedly returns whenever you resume activity, the injury may need a more structured rehabilitation plan.
Athletes whose performance depends heavily on sprinting or explosive forefoot loading may benefit from earlier sports medicine evaluation even when the injury initially appears moderate. Accurate grading can help prevent an overly aggressive return that prolongs recovery.
What Happens If Turf Toe Is Left Untreated?
A minor Grade 1 sprain may eventually settle with natural activity reduction, but repeatedly stressing the joint can make recovery longer than necessary.
Moderate injuries that are ignored may remain painful and weak. The athlete may compensate by changing their gait, which can create additional stress throughout the foot and lower limb.
Severe untreated injuries pose greater concern because complete disruption of the stabilizing tissues can produce chronic joint instability. Once the injury becomes chronic, treatment can become more complicated.
Persistent turf toe has been associated with chronic pain and difficulty returning to previous activity levels, which is why early protection and appropriate rehabilitation matter.
Common Turf Toe Recovery Mistakes
One of the most common mistakes is returning to sport as soon as ordinary walking becomes comfortable. Walking does not place the same load through the big toe as sprinting, jumping, or cutting.
Another mistake is repeatedly testing the injury by aggressively bending the big toe backward. Excessive hyperextension recreates the mechanism responsible for the sprain and can irritate healing tissue.
Athletes may also rely too heavily on pain medication, taping, or stiff inserts while ignoring persistent weakness and instability. These tools can protect the joint, but they do not replace rehabilitation.
Finally, some athletes become overly cautious and immobilize a mild injury longer than necessary. Once the tissue is ready, appropriate progressive movement helps restore normal mobility and strength. The ideal balance depends on injury severity.
Final Thoughts on Turf Toe
Turf toe is a sprain of the structures supporting the big toe’s first MTP joint, typically caused when the toe bends upward too far while the forefoot remains planted. It is common in sports involving sprinting, cutting, jumping, and explosive push-off.
Symptoms can include big toe pain, swelling, tenderness, bruising, stiffness, and difficulty pushing off. Grade 1 injuries involve mild stretching, Grade 2 injuries involve partial tearing, and Grade 3 turf toe involves complete disruption of the plantar plate.
Treatment ranges from brief rest, ice, taping, and stiff-soled footwear for mild cases to walking boots, physical therapy, and longer periods of protection for more severe injuries. Surgery is uncommon but may be necessary for selected severe Grade 3 injuries.
Recovery should be guided by function rather than urgency to return. Mild injuries may improve within about a week, while severe cases may take two to six months. Giving the joint enough time to heal and gradually rebuilding strength can help reduce recurrent pain and support a safer return to sport.
Frequently Asked Questions About Turf Toe
What Is the Fastest Way to Heal Turf Toe?
Protect the big toe from painful hyperextension, reduce aggravating activity, use appropriate cold therapy, and follow footwear or rehabilitation recommendations. Severe injuries should be professionally assessed rather than rushed.
Can You Walk With Turf Toe?
Many people can walk with mild turf toe, although pushing through the big toe may hurt. Moderate or severe injuries may require a stiff shoe, walking boot, or temporary reduction in weight-bearing.
How Long Does Turf Toe Take to Heal?
Grade 1 injuries may improve within about a week, Grade 2 injuries may need several weeks, and severe Grade 3 turf toe can take two to six months depending on the extent of damage.
Does Turf Toe Need Surgery?
Most cases do not require surgery. Surgery may be considered for severe Grade 3 injuries involving major instability, complete structural disruption, dislocation, or symptoms that fail to improve with appropriate nonsurgical treatment.
Can Turf Toe Come Back?
Yes. Reinjury is possible, particularly when an athlete returns before the joint has regained adequate strength, motion, and stability. Appropriate rehabilitation, supportive footwear, inserts, or taping may help reduce recurrence.
